A rosette made of many rounded petals radiates from a small, dark center. Inside the larger shapes, repeated thinner outlines create additional layers. Numerous straight lines fan out from the center, forming fans between the petals. The entire image is symmetrical and based on clean, smooth arcs, making the coloring page look even from every side.
In school, this pattern is perfect for art class when students compare color choices. It helps practice mindfulness and hand control while tracing lines along the arcs. This printable encourages calm filling of spaces, as each element has a clear outline. The illustration also facilitates discussions about symmetry, as the same shapes recur at equal intervals. The inner petal near the center organizes the entire layout, as it starts the subsequent layers of repeating forms. It looks great when colored in blue and green, as the double outline clearly separates the two colors. Use colored pencils and shade from the edges to the center with light strokes.
